How they compare
Benin currently reports 4.23 trillion Domestic currency against 4.02 trillion Domestic currency in Ukraine, a difference of 204.41 billion Domestic currency.
That makes Benin's figure about 1.1 times Ukraine's.
Across all 9 years both countries report, Benin has been ahead every year.
Benin ranks 30th and Ukraine ranks 31st of 74 countries.
Benin has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

About this data
The Monetary and Financial Statistics (MFS), Monetary Aggregates dataset presents monetary aggregates based on standardized SRF data, while also reflecting country-specific components aligned with national definitions.
